The Delhi Police Constable examination is a highly sought-after recruitment drive conducted by the Staff Selection Commission (SSC) on behalf of the Delhi Police. This exam serves as the gateway for aspiring individuals to join the prestigious Delhi Police force as Constables (Executive). The role of a Delhi Police Constable is vital in maintaining law and order, ensuring public safety, and serving the citizens of the nation's capital. The examination process is rigorous, designed to select candidates with the right aptitude, physical fitness, and mental fortitude. Success in this exam not only offers a stable and respectable career in government service but also provides an opportunity to contribute directly to society and uphold justice. The career benefits are substantial, including competitive salaries, attractive allowances, job security, opportunities for promotion, and a pension scheme. Furthermore, it instills a sense of pride and responsibility, making it a fulfilling career choice for those dedicated to public service.

Choosing a career as a Delhi Police Constable offers a stable and rewarding path with significant opportunities for growth and development. Upon successful completion of the recruitment process, Constables are entrusted with the critical responsibility of maintaining law and order, ensuring public safety, and assisting citizens in various capacities. The career progression within the Delhi Police is structured, allowing Constables to rise through the ranks to positions like Head Constable, Assistant Sub-Inspector, Sub-Inspector, and beyond, based on performance, experience, and departmental examinations. The salary package is competitive, comprising a basic pay, Dearness Allowance (DA), House Rent Allowance (HRA), and other allowances as per government norms. Beyond financial benefits, the role provides immense job satisfaction, a sense of purpose, and the opportunity to serve the community directly. Perks include medical facilities, leave entitlements, and a contributory pension scheme, making it an attractive and secure career choice for dedicated individuals.

The Delhi Police Constable examination is a multi-stage recruitment process designed to select eligible candidates for the Constable (Executive) post in the Delhi Police. The stages typically include:

  1. Computer Based Examination (CBE): This is the first stage, an objective-type written test to assess the candidates' knowledge in various subjects.
  2. Physical Endurance Test (PET) and Physical Measurement Test (PMT): Candidates who qualify in the CBE are then required to undergo PET and PMT to assess their physical fitness and measurements.
  3. Document Verification: Successful candidates from the PET/PMT stage will have their documents verified.
  4. Medical Examination: A final medical examination is conducted to ensure candidates meet the required health standards.

The Computer Based Examination consists of four sections: General Knowledge/Current Affairs, Reasoning Ability, Numerical Ability, and Computer Fundamentals. The total duration for the CBE is typically 90 minutes.


  1. Visit the Official Website: Go to the official website of the Staff Selection Commission (SSC) or the Delhi Police recruitment portal.
  2. Find the Notification: Look for the latest notification regarding the Delhi Police Constable recruitment and click on the 'Apply Online' link.
  3. Registration: If you are a new user, you will need to register by providing basic details like name, father's name, mother's name, date of birth, email ID, and mobile number. You will receive a registration ID and password.
  4. Login: Log in using your registration ID and password.
  5. Fill the Application Form: Complete the online application form with accurate personal, educational, and contact details.
  6. Upload Documents: Upload scanned copies of your photograph and signature in the prescribed format and size.
  7. Pay Application Fee: Pay the application fee online through the available payment gateways (Net Banking, Credit/Debit Card, UPI).
  8. Submit Application: Review all the details filled in the form and submit the application.
  9. Print Application Form: Take a printout of the submitted application form for your records.
